A welcoming and inclusive primary school in Lambeth, a short walk from Streatham Common Station, is seeking a committed KS2 Teaching Assistant to join their team as soon as possible, with the role running through to July 2026.

Why join this school as a KS2 Teaching Assistant?

  • Support teaching and learning across Years 3-6
  • Assist with small group work and individual interventions
  • Work closely with experienced teachers and SEN staff
  • Be part of a warm, collaborative school community
  • Excellent transport links and modern classroom resources

What they're looking for:

  • Previous experience as a KS2 Teaching Assistant or in a similar support role
  • Confident working with children aged 7-11
  • Strong communication and organisational skills
  • A patient, proactive, and positive attitude
  • A valid DBS on the update service (or willingness to apply)

We think this is how you could land KS2 Teaching Assistant

✨Tip Number 1

Familiarise yourself with the National Curriculum for KS2. Understanding the key learning objectives and how they are assessed will help you demonstrate your knowledge during interviews and show that you're ready to support teachers effectively.

✨Tip Number 2

Gain some hands-on experience by volunteering or shadowing in a primary school setting, especially with KS2 students. This will not only enhance your CV but also give you real-life examples to discuss during your interview.

✨Tip Number 3

Network with current teaching assistants or educators in your area. They can provide valuable insights into the role and may even know of opportunities that aren't widely advertised, giving you an edge in your job search.

✨Tip Number 4

Prepare to discuss your approach to supporting children with different learning needs. Being able to articulate strategies for differentiation and inclusion will show that you are proactive and ready to contribute positively to the school environment.
